18 Bible Verses about Accountability

Most Relevant Verses

Luke 12:48

He who did not know and did things unacceptable will receive a lesser punishment. To whom much is given, much will be required and to whom they commit much they will demand even more.

Revelation 20:12

I saw the dead, small and great, stand before God. The books were opened: and another book was opened, which is the book of life: and the dead were judged according to the things written in the books, according to their works.

Romans 3:19

We know that whatever the law says, it speaks to those under the law. Every mouth may be stopped and the entire world may become liable to God for punishment.

Ezekiel 33:8

Suppose I say to a wicked person, 'You wicked person, you will certainly die.' And you say nothing to warn him to change his ways. That wicked person will die because of his sin. I will hold you responsible for his death.

Daniel 6:2

Three commissioners were placed over them. Daniel was one of the commissioners. These governors were to give account to them so that the king would not suffer loss.

Psalm 10:13

Why does the wicked person despise God? Why does he say in his heart: God does not require it?

Ezekiel 3:20

If righteous people turn from living the right way and do wrong, I will make them stumble and they will die. If you do not warn them, they will die because of their sin. The right things they did will not be remembered. I will hold you responsible for their deaths.

Ezekiel 33:6

But if the watchman sees the enemy coming and does not blow his horn to warn the people and the enemy comes and kills someone, that watchman must die because of his sin. I will hold him responsible for their deaths.'

Romans 2:12

For all who have sinned without law will perish without law. All who have sinned under law will be judged under law.

Accountability » Everyone giving account of themselves to God

Matthew 12:36-37

I tell you there will be an account in the Judgment Day for every careless word that men say. For by your words you will be justified, and by your words you will be condemned.

Romans 14:10-12

Why do you judge your brother? Why do you look down on your brother with contempt? We will all stand before the judgment seat of God (Theos). It is written: As I live, says Jehovah, every knee will bow to me, and every tongue will acknowledge (confess to) Jehovah. (Isaiah 45:23) So then every one of us will give account of himself to God.
